The proper length of one spaceship is three times that of another. The two spaceships are traveling in the same direction and, while both are passing overhead, an Earth observer measures the two spaceships to have the same length. If the slower spaceship has a speed of 0.350c with respect to Earth, determine the speed of the faster spaceship.
